D Janet Dudkiewicz 1924 - 1987

D Janet Dudkiewicz of Batavia, Genesee County, NY was born on December 28, 1924, and died at age 63 years old in December 1987.

In 1924, in the year that D Janet Dudkiewicz was born, J. Edgar Hoover, at the age of 29, was appointed the sixth director of the Bureau of Investigation by Calvin Coolidge (which later became the Federal Bureau of Investigation). The Bureau had approximately 650 employees, including 441 Special Agents. A former employee of the Justice Department, Hoover accepted his new position on the proviso that the bureau was to be completely divorced from politics and that the director report only to the attorney general.
